Output f3da81b6894f860b1a57c6b3a3fc559efa488172ac00fd186fdb336522b71c58:2

value
166269083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70fe4895b84f13e4a6cf46b6f95cccbb7447c036 OP_EQUAL
address
MJCcXqxYgP8z4JsUhhptFdnMZ1Fd3z6hLh
transaction
f3da81b6894f860b1a57c6b3a3fc559efa488172ac00fd186fdb336522b71c58
spent
true